Oak Hill Academy is a coeducational, nonsectarian private day school located in Lincroft, New Jersey, serving students in pre-kindergarten through eighth grade. Oak Hill Academy was founded in 1980 by educator Joseph A. Pacelli, and has a current enrollment of 180 students.
